More

    Editor's Pick

    [ALGORITHM] BREADTH FIRST SEARCH (BFS) GRAPH ALGORITHM

    Breadth First Search (BFS) is a graph traversal algorithm where we scan the nodes level by level i.e. we visit each of...

    LOGARITHMIC TIME COMPLEXITY (ASYMPTOTIC ANALYSIS)

    Complexity of  an algorithm is O(logn) if it cut the problem size by a fraction (usually by half).

    REFERENCE MATERIALS – SOFTWARE ARCHITECTURE

    These are the materials I have referred to learn and prepare notes for Software Architecture.  Software Architecture in...

    DISTRIBUTED COMPUTING – RECORDED LECTURES (BITS)

    Module 1 - INTRODUCTION Recorded Lecture - 1.1 Introduction Part I – Definition

    [ALGORITHM] MERGE SORT

    To understand merge sort you should be aware about recursion and divide and conquer technique.   In Merge sort, we...

    OAUTH – FREQUENTLY ASKED QUESTIONS FOR INTERVIEWS AND SELF EVALUATION

    Why is refresh token needed when you have access token? Access tokens are usually short-lived and refresh tokens are...

    New report seems to reveal future of Apple line-up

    In May, Uber launched a new experiment: selling train and bus tickets through its app for its customers in Denver, Colorado. Today, the company...

    NEED AND IMPORTANCE OF CLOUD COMPUTING

    Cloud Computing is a business model that enable on-demand network access to a shared pool of resources that can be rapidly provisioned...

    COURSE PROPOSAL: AWS MASTER COURSE

    MODULES AND TOPICS AWS Getting StartedTopics:Cloud computing and AWS Essentials.IAM, S3 and Security Policies.Credits: 4Most Essential DevOpsTopics:CloudWatch...

    GIT – USEFUL COMMANDS

    Discard all local changes, but save them for possible re-use later:  git stash Discarding local changes...

    New From Gadgets

    Oracle Arrays – VARRAYs and Nested Table Arrays (AS TABLE OF)

    Oracle collections are database types that allow you to store sets of elements, similar to arrays and collections in Java. Storing data...

    INTRODUCTION TO SOFTWARE CRAFTSMANSHIP

    Agile software development is a group of software development methods based on iterative and incremental development, where requirements and solutions evolve through...

    SERVICE ORIENTATION – IMPORTANT TERMS AND CONCEPTS

    Service orientation is a design paradigm for computer software in the form of services. Applying service-orientation results in units of software partitioned...

    LINKED LIST VS. ARRAYS

    Linked Lists and Arrays can be used for storing a list of data. Arrays are...

    IMPORTANT CHARACTERISTICS OF CLOUD COMPUTING

    The US National Institute of Standards and Technology (NIST) has identified five essential characteristics of cloud computing such as on-demand self service,...

    GETTING STARTED WITH CLOUDERA QUICKSTART VM

    Installing and setting up Apache Hadoop is always a challenge for beginners. However there are few ready made solutions available to get...

    Stay on op - Ge the daily news in your inbox

    Trending In Mobile

    WRITING CLEANER METHODS IN YOUR PROGRAM

    Below simple list of principles and practices can help you write cleaner methods in your program: Methods should...

    [ALGORITHM] DEPTH FIRST SEARCH (DFS) GRAPH ALGORITHM

    Depth First Search (DFS) is a graph traversal algorithm where we scan until we reach the depth (leaf node) through any path...

    WEB DEVELOPMENT – IMPORTANT TERMS AND CONCEPTS

    We will discuss important terms and concepts related to Web Development here. Web Browser (commonly referred to as a...

    Advanced Computer Networks – Recorded Lectures (BITS)

    Module 1: Internet Architecture & Next Generation Design Recorded Lecture 1.1: Internet architecture and next generation internet design Introduction to the course https://youtu.be/aKFYq495cms Internet Architecture and Functionalities https://youtu.be/P-YNRITHMIA https://youtu.be/_7am2iKD96Y Module 2:...

    FaceTime bug that let hackers listen in secretly

    In May, Uber launched a new experiment: selling train and bus tickets through its app for its customers in Denver, Colorado. Today, the company...

    Additional Examples for Stored Procedures and Stored Functions in MySQL

    Here we will discuss examples for different use cases for stored procedures and stored functions. Please refer to the note on ‘Stored...

    IMPORTANT UML DIAGRAMS REQUIRED TO WORK WITH OBJECT ORIENTED DESIGN PATTERNS

    There is a saying that a picture can speak thousand words. UML diagrams are those pictures which can speak all those words...

    Entertainment

    CD AND DEVOPS – IMPORTANT TERMS AND CONCEPTS

    This page will contain a list of important terms and concepts related to DevOps, DevOps practices, tools etc. with links for further...

    SUMO LOGIC VIDEOS AND TUTORIALS

    Sumo Logic Basics - Part 1 of 2 (link is external) (Sep 29, 2016)Sumo Logic Basics - Part 2 of 2...

    SOFTWARE ARCHITECTURES – RECORDED LECTURES (BITS)

    This page contains pre-recorded lectures provided by BITS on the topic Software Architectures as part of Semester 1 (Second Semester 2017-18) for...

    Science

    Cursors in Oracle PL/SQL

    You can retrieve the rows into the cursor using a query and then fetch the rows one at a time from the...

    TIPS AND GUIDELINES FOR WRITING EDUCATIONAL CONTENTS

    Here are few tips and guidelines for writing content. This page contains running notes. More points and explanations will be added.

    Installing and Setting up MySQL Community Server on Windows for Development

    MySQL is provided in two editions primarily: the commercial MySQL Enterprise Edition and the open MySQL Community Edition. We will try to...

    Latest Articles

    OAUTH – FREQUENTLY ASKED QUESTIONS FOR INTERVIEWS AND SELF EVALUATION

    Why is refresh token needed when you have access token? Access tokens are usually short-lived and refresh tokens are...

    SUMO LOGIC VIDEOS AND TUTORIALS

    Sumo Logic Basics - Part 1 of 2 (link is external) (Sep 29, 2016)Sumo Logic Basics - Part 2 of 2...

    GIT – USEFUL COMMANDS

    Discard all local changes, but save them for possible re-use later:  git stash Discarding local changes...

    DISTRIBUTED COMPUTING – RECORDED LECTURES (BITS)

    Module 1 - INTRODUCTION Recorded Lecture - 1.1 Introduction Part I – Definition

    BOOK REVIEW GUIDELINES FOR COOKBOOKS

    Whenever you add reviews for the book, please follow below rules. Write issues in an excel.Create an excel...

    ET – LICENSE DISCUSSION

    Please use this page to discuss about which license to use for the Simple Expense Tracker project. Suggest your opinion with your...

    ET – DESIGN DECISIONS

    Package name: Plural vs Singular (controllers vs controller, services vs service etc..) Packages assists with organization of code and...

    ET – RAW NOTES – SNEHA

    Created account in bitbucket.downloaded sourcetree and Installed sourcetree.While installing sourcetree, created account at Atlassian and configured. Sourcetree prompted for creating ssh key...

    ET – RAW NOTES

    Page maintained to track all activities that we do. Updated by Heartin and Sneha. Created a reposiroty in...

    TIPS AND GUIDELINES FOR WRITING EDUCATIONAL CONTENTS

    Here are few tips and guidelines for writing content. This page contains running notes. More points and explanations will be added.

    OPEN SOURCE PROJECT FOR EDUCATION (OSPE) POOL FOR REAL WORLD PROJECT EXPERIENCE WITH TRAINING

    All technology courses should be taught hands on. Only when you work on a real problem and make your hands dirty you...

    MEMBERSHIP FEE BASED OPEN LEARNING – PROPOSAL

    We can follow a membership-fee based open learning where we can attend any program or course we want to attend, rather than...